• Asset-Based: discovers gifts & talents in the community right now

• Internally-Focused: Relies on community’s strengths, not on outside resources

• Relationship-Driven: Seeks to connect local people, associations and institutions

Asset-Based Community Development

Needs vs. Assets

Needs Based1. Focus on

deficiencies

2. People are consumers of services

3. Residents observe as issues are being addressed

Asset Based1. Focus on

effectiveness

2. People are producers

3. Residents participate and are empowered

We all have assets and deficits.

Community Assets

• Individuals– Everybody!

• Associations– Social Assets

• Institutions– Public, private, nonprofit

• Physical Assets– Buildings, natural assets

• Exchange– Financial transactions and other exchanges
